How exposed is Jordan Valley to wildfire?
Jordan Valley sits at the 96th percentile nationally for wildfire risk to structures — in USFS's highest wildfire-risk band nationally — per USFS's Wildfire Risk to Communities model, built from its 292 counted buildings, not vegetation cover alone. (Source: USFS's Wildfire Risk to Communities methodology.)
USFS's separate burn-probability score — fire likelihood alone, before counting what's built there — puts Jordan Valley at the 97th percentile, close to its 96th-percentile risk score.
Where Jordan Valley's buildings actually sit
Of Jordan Valley's 292 counted buildings, 60.6% carry Direct exposure and only 0% carry Minimal — a lopsided split that puts defensible-space clearing ahead of vents or roofing as the intervention worth doing first.
Where Jordan Valley ranks
Jordan Valley scores 96th nationally and 87th within Oregon — close enough that its state context doesn't change the picture the national number already gives. Among the 31,521 US communities USFS scores, Jordan Valley ranks 1,208 for wildfire risk (1 is highest) and 21,861 by building count (1 is largest).
